Fastmm preparing your apps to report memory leaks delphi bistro one of the most challenging parts of inheriting a legacy project is to fix the memory leaks that most often are hiding in the code. Find answers to delphi 5 sound control from the expert community at experts exchange. Rapid application development with the firemonkey framework means a faster way to design, develop, integrate, test, and deploy apps. Find answers to delphi tab control from the expert community at experts exchange. Code issues 41 pull requests 2 actions projects 0 security insights. The user selects a page by clicking the mouse on its tab. The packages shown on these pages are distributed as shareware. Xfiles components download the best advanced dbgrid. Mar 10, 2020 o componente tem suporte do delphi 7 ate o delphi 10.
Versao dos componentes user control mantido pela comunidade show delphi maurilima usercontrol sd. Phone master detail demo for delphi xe6 firemonkey fmx demos. But if youve got the classic problem of code creating objects and placing them in a container somewhere and then abandoning them, you can have a huge memory leak in your program without it ever being detected, just as long as the container gets properly. Fastmm4 download available for delphi xe3 the wiert corner. If nothing happens, download the github extension for visual studio and try again. Embarcadero delphi 10 seattle is the fastest way to build and update datarich, hyper connected, visually engaging applications for windows 10, mac, mobile, iot and more. Here are the comparison of the original fastmm4 version 4. Fastmm is a lightning fast replacement memory manager for embarcadero delphi win32 and win64 applications that is not prone to memory fragmentation, and supports shared memory without the use of external. Delphi will add it to your uses clause automatically when you do that, but you will still need to edit the dpr file to make sure fastmm4 appears at the front of the list. Supports ado, dbx, ibx, bde, ibo, uib, midas, fibplus, zeosdbo, dbisam, mdo, mydac, mysqldac and asta3.
One of the most frequently asked questions during the migration to a new product version is regarding third party component compatibility. Its features pretty much make memory leaks trivial to track down usually. Open source delphi component for user access control. In this session, we have seen just about every aspect of delphi component building.
Hello, if this is not the right newsgroup, please let me know where i should be posting to and i will try there. It uses the same ownership mechanism as forms for automatic instantiation and destruction of the components on it, and the same parentchild relationships for synchronization of component properties. Fastmm slow in multithreaded apps on multicore cpus. I am having some confusion with the memory leak report from fastmm 4. Fastmm is a lightning fast replacement memory manager for embarcadero delphi win32 and win64 applications that is not prone to memory fragmentation, and supports shared memory without the use of. Delphi 10 seattle product tour embarcadero website.
Using delphi 7 and delphi 2010 i had a project in delphi 7. There are already some basic introductions at stackoverflow, or the eurekalog blog. Well i took a quick look at the source has no package for 2006, which. Using fastmm4 for debugging your memory allocations part 1. I have downloaded it from sourceforge and placed fastmm4messages. I am willing to look at commercial products as well.
Tutorial for creating your own custom controls and components. Fastmm is a lightning fast replacement memory manager for embarcadero delphi win32 and win64 applications that is not prone to memory fragmentation, fastmm browse fastmm 4. Delphi and kylix component package to user and profile management and access control. If you set the fulldebugmode directive in the ide, build your project. Memory manager extension for leak checking with firemonkey in delphi 10 seattle on android. Using tabs, a user can select one of the possible pages. Tms pack for firemonkey contains the page slider component rapid application development with the firemonkey framework means a faster way to design, develop, integrate, test, and deploy apps. To change the activepage to the page that precedes or follows the active page, use the selectnextpage method. Tms page slider demo for delphi xe6 firemonkey fmx demos. You can use two controls to build a multiplepage application in delphi. Tutorial for creating your own custom controls and components in firemonkey by admin on september 28, 2015 developer ray konopka takes a deep dive into the firemonkey framework and explains how to create your own custom firemonkey controls and components. When you need to display a lot of information and controls in a dialog box or a form, you can use multiple pages. Using this page, you may download their trial versions.
A frame tframe, like a form, is a container for other components. Tdatamodule descendants exposing interfaces, or the introduction of a tinterfaceddatamodule. Mar 28, 20 one of the awesome things about fastmm is fulldebugmode. Fastmm4 download available for delphi xe3 posted by jpluimers on 20120905 at the day of the delphi xe3 release piere le riche released the download version of fastmm4 now version 4. Fastmm4 has improved since 2010, but it is still has room for improvement when it comes to multithreaded applications.